Newbourne is a village in Suffolk, UK, characterized by its diverse landscapes suitable for outdoor pursuits. The region features picturesque river paths along the River Deben Estuary, open countryside, and significant wetland areas, including the Newbourne Springs Nature Reserve. Its network of trails is situated within the Suffolk Coast & Heaths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ty, offering varied terrain for several sports like road cycling, hiking, jogging, touring cycling, and more.

Newbourne features the River Deben Estuary, offering scenic views along its paths. The Newbourne Springs Nature Reserve is a Site of Special Scientific Interest (SSSI) with diverse habitats including woodland, marsh, fen, and heathland. The area is also part of the Suffolk Coast & Heaths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ty.

The terrain for cycling in Newbourne is generally flat and low-lying, characteristic of the Suffolk Coast & Heaths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ty. Road cycling routes feature mostly well-paved surfaces. Some routes may include unpaved segments, particularly for mountain biking or gravel biking.
